Oakdale, WI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Oakdale?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Oakdale 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,263 | $800 | $1,950 |
| Oakdale 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,592 | $850 | $2,500 |
| Oakdale 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,270 | $1,695 | $2,650 |
| Oakdale 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,139 | $2,750 | $4,195 |
| Oakdale 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,400 | $2,400 | $2,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Oakdale
What type of rentals are currently available in Oakdale?
There are currently 54 Apartments for Rent in Oakdale, WI with pricing that ranges from $450 to $2,600. There are also 44 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Oakdale ranging from $600 to $50,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Oakdale?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Oakdale ranges from $600 to $50,000 with an average monthly rent of $3,436.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Oakdale?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Oakdale range from $686 to $2,600,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$850 to $2,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,695 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$760.
